I buy quite a bit of their brand yarns. The Herrschner's "8" is a very good buy when it is on sale. The big drawback is that it is a horrible mess to untangle often. It also often has lots of flaws to cut out. It still is a great bargain, and it is soft, not stiff like the cheaper "Red Heart" yarns. I have some on order right now that should be here by Mon. This time I ordered some of their afghan yarn, much lighter in weight, to make a sweater for my son. Annalia
